Do any of you happen to know if the auger bits sold at Tractor Supply will fit the gear box on my Lienbach 7300? I need a new bit for mine and if they fit I'd like to try the TSC one because it looks like it's got a better pilot on it to help start the bit into the ground.

No, the Lienbach uses an oddball tip and cutting teeth combination, only the Lienbach will fit it. The cutting teeth/pilot was the downside of the Lienbach augers when we tested them.

I'm not looking to change out my tip only, but the complete auger bit. I looked at them at TSC today and took some measurements. The spacing on the bolt holes is 3/4" and 2 3/4" on the Leinbach as measured from the top of the bit. The one at TSC is 1" and 3". So the spacing between the two holes is the same, I've just got to see if when the Leinbach bit was bolted up to my gear box it had an extra 1/4 of clearance on the shaft. The Leinbach auger bits are weak at the point where they bolt onto the gear box, so far I've had two break in that location. John
 
   / Will TSC auger bits fit on a Lienbach PHD? #4  
You could always cut 1/4" off from the top of the TSC model to gain the 1/4" difference. Did you check the shaft diameters too?? That would be a problem if there was more than 1/8" play between the shaft and the recessed area on the bit.

Sorry, I misunderstood, yes, the augers will interchange. Should use the same gearbox. The DP augers that some TSC stores sell may/may not interchange depending on the guards on the Lienbach... The new "Fieldmaster" augers are reinforced where you are breaking the Lienbach augers.

I twisted mine off there and just cut it off and drilled two sets of holes lower on the auger shaft. The next time I twisted the auger in half right where the flanges on the 12" auger stop on the auger shaft. I bought a "no name" 12" auger used from a roadside farm shop a year or so ago and it worked on my 7400. So far, so good. You're right though, the auger is the weak point. The gear box has taken some abuse and I've not had any issues.

I bought one of the auger bits at TSC and it bolted right up to my Lienbach PHD. This bit is much better than what Lienbach sells. As some of you mentioned where it bolts up to the gearbox is reinforced and is about 3 x the thickness of the Lienbach PHD. It's also got a better cutting edge and it looks like the pilot on this one will help keep the bit from dancing around as much at the Lienbach did.
